dishwasher will not power on no lights or response from touch buttons,checked power at the splice box on the botton of the dish washer 120vac present,checked door switsche both micri switches have continuity.checked the thermal fuse disconnected from leads it also has continuity.checked voltag across leads that connect to thermal fuse 118vac present. ??? what am i missing what could be keeping this washer from working ? thanks

Most likely the problem is a bad key panel which is a part of the console but there is a small chance for the control board to be bad as well. I would replace the console first.
